Listening to Beethoven
Dream-like melodies
Thunderous roars
Tranquil pauses
Expansive orchestration
Floods swell deep in my heart
Shallows murmur in my ears
His are urgent insistent sounds
Music for the hungering soul
He wills to grasp infinity
A valiant show of Romanticism

City Dawn by Kong Shiu Loon
A single bird calls for chirps to wake
To announce the awaiting day-break
The sky a greenish grey
Tinted with a pastel yellow haze
The park is yet to be occupied
Up high a lone eagle leisurely glides
Suddenly a distant siren interrupts the quiet peace
A possible tragedy in precarious urban existence
An Eagle__SL Kong
It is a windy day
The sky a dark grey
Tree tops on sway
Up the air an eagle glides looking for prey
Ir soars high far and near
Sweeping at lightening speed with no fear
Suddenly it plunges down off my sight
I wish it a catch it might
